Anyway I still get e-mails because of my past involvement with WA3. Here is the most recent. I thought I would post it and see if anyone had any ideas for this guy.

E-mail....
I know that sounds very weird but I'll explain. The new Toshiba e800 series PDA has true VGA resolution (sort of, it's 480x640 rather than the other way around) and because of this the built in windows media player ends up being only a quarter of the size of the screen since the normal resolution of a PocketPC is 240x320. However, there is a third party media player based on winamp that uses standard winamp skins. The thing is that due to the standard size of winamp, this program also only displays at 25% of the screen size and on a 4" screen, that's too small.
What I was hoping is that you could create a skin that would fit the 480x640 size format of the PDA. I have never skinned anything before and thought that someone with your skinning expertize could make a simple, basic, skin without too much trouble. At this point it doesn't have to be anything fancy, just functional to see if it will work. If I'm not mistaken, it would need to be exactly twice the size of the regular winamp skins.
Please let me know and thanks in advance for any help you can provide.

End E-mail..
